The Chef’s Secret: The Power of Gently Softened Cream Cheese
What truly sets this cherry cheesecake fluff apart is the simple yet crucial technique of “gently softening” the cream cheese. Instead of microwaving it into submission, we let it come to room temperature naturally. This ensures the cream cheese is perfectly pliable for beating but still holds its structure, creating a smoother, more stable base that won’t curdle. When cream cheese is too cold, it results in lumps; if it’s over-melted and hot, it can become too liquid and affect the final texture. Ingredient Spotlight: Quality Makes the Difference
8 oz Cream Cheese, Softened: The heart and soul of our cheesecake fluff, cream cheese provides that essential tangy richness and creamy base. For the best texture, ensure it’s properly softened (at room temperature) for a smooth, lump-free mixture. If you prefer a lighter version, low-fat cream cheese works, but full-fat offers the most decadent flavor and texture. Don’t compromise here – creamy is key!
1 cup Powdered Sugar: Also known as confectioners’ sugar, this ultra-fine sugar dissolves easily, lending sweetness without any grittiness. It’s essential for achieving that smooth, melt-in-your-mouth texture characteristic of a perfect cheesecake fluff. If you find yourself out, you can technically make your own by blending granulated sugar in a high-powered blender until very fine, but it’s best to stick to store-bought for guaranteed results.
1 teaspoon Vanilla Extract: Vanilla extract is the silent power player that enhances all the other flavors. Use pure vanilla extract for the most authentic and robust aroma and taste; imitation vanilla extract can sometimes leave a slightly artificial aftertaste. A good quality vanilla is crucial for that classic, comforting cheesecake flavor profile.
8 oz Frozen Whipped Topping, Thawed: This is what gives our dessert its signature “fluff.” Thawed whipped topping (like Cool Whip) is incredibly stable and light, creating an airy texture that’s impossible to achieve with homemade whipped cream alone for this particular recipe. Make sure it’s fully thawed but still cold before folding it in to maintain its loftiness and integrate smoothly.
21 oz Cherry Pie Filling: The crowning glory! This canned filling provides a burst of sweet, slightly tart cherry flavor and a beautiful visual contrast. High-quality pie filling makes a noticeable difference. Look for one with plump cherries and a rich, glossy sauce. While you can use homemade cherry compote, a good canned filling is unsurpassed for convenience and a classic dessert experience.
Step-by-Step Instructions
Step 1: Preparing the Cream Cheese Base
In a large mixing bowl, begin by beating the softened cream cheese. Use an electric mixer (handheld or stand mixer with a paddle attachment) on medium speed until the cream cheese is completely smooth and free of any lumps. This initial step is crucial for a silky-smooth final texture. Ensure your cream cheese is at room temperature for optimal results.
Pro Tip: For an extra smooth base, you can sift the powdered sugar before gradually adding it to the beaten cream cheese. This helps prevent any tiny lumps from forming and ensures a velvety-smooth consistency.
Step 2: Sweetening and Flavoring
Gradually add the powdered sugar and vanilla extract to the smoothed cream cheese. Continue mixing on low speed until just combined, then increase to medium speed and beat for another minute or two until the mixture is well-combined, fluffy, and has a uniform pale yellow color. Scrape down the sides of the bowl as needed to ensure everything is incorporated.
Common Mistake to Avoid: Overmixing the cream cheese and sugar mixture can sometimes incorporate too much air at this stage, which, when combined with the whipped topping later, can lead to a texture that is too airy and potentially unstable. Mix until just incorporated and fluffy.
Step 3: Incorporating the Fluffiness
Gently add the thawed frozen whipped topping to the cream cheese mixture. Using a spatula, fold the whipped topping into the cream cheese base. Be gentle – you want to incorporate it fully without deflating the airy texture of both components. Continue folding until no streaks of cream cheese remain and the mixture is uniformly light and fluffy.
Step 4: Assembling the Dessert
Spoon the incredibly fluffy cheesecake mixture into individual serving dishes (like ramekins or small bowls), or a single larger serving bowl. You can also pipe it if you’re feeling fancy! Ensure the layers are relatively even for a pleasing presentation. This easy no-bake dessert comes together in minutes.
Step 5: Adding the Cherry Topping and Chilling
Generously spoon the cherry pie filling over the top of the cheesecake fluff in each dish or the large bowl. Make sure to get a good amount of cherries and sauce. Cover the dishes and ref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ving. This chilling time allows the flavors to meld and the fluff to set slightly, ensuring a delightful texture.

Make-Ahead & Storage Solutions
One of the greatest joys of this easy cherry dessert is its flexibility. The cheesecake fluff mixture (without the cherry topping) can be prepared up to 2 days in advance and st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ator. This is a lifesaver for busy hosts! On the day of serving, simply spoon the fluff into your dishes and top with the cherry pie filling. Leftovers will keep in the refrigerator, covered, for up to 3 days, though the texture is best enjoyed within the first 2 days. It does not freeze well, as the whipped topping can lose its airy quality upon thawing.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
How long does cherry cheesecake fluff need to chill?
For the best flavor and texture, your cherry cheesecake fluff should chill for at least 1 hour.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ully and the mixture to firm up slightly, ensuring it’s delightfully fluffy yet holds its shape when scooped.
Can I use frozen cherries in cherry cheesecake fluff?
Yes, you can! If using frozen cherries, thaw them completely and then cook them down with a little sugar and a thickening agent (like cornstarch or tapioca starch mixed with water) until a thick, syrupy consistency is reached. Let this homemade cherry topping cool completely before spooning it over your fluff. This will give you a fresh, homemade cherry flavor profile.
What is the best way to thicken cherry cheesecake fluff?
This cheesecake fluff recipe is designed to be light and airy, so it doesn’t require thickening in the traditional sense. The combination of cream cheese and whipped topping naturally creates a decadent, creamy texture. If for some reason yours seems too soft, ensure your cream cheese was fully softened but not warm, and that your whipped topping was fully thawed but still cold when folded in. Chilling thoroughly is key to achieving the perfect consistency.
How do you make cherry cheesecake fluff without cream cheese?
To make a cream cheese-free version of this fluffy cherry cheesecake, you can try using a base of whipped coconut cream (the thick part from a can of chilled full-fat coconut milk) and possibly a dairy-free cream cheese alternative. Combine this with powdered sugar and vanilla, then fold in your whipped topping (ensure it’s dairy-free if aiming for vegan). The texture might be slightly different, but it can achieve a lovely, light dessert.
Can I use fresh cherries instead of pie filling?
Absolutely! If you have fresh cherries, you can pit them and simmer them with a bit of sugar and a tablespoon or two of lemon juice until they break down slightly and create a compote. You might need to add a teaspoon of cornstarch slurry to thicken it to your desired consistency. Cool completely before topping your fluff.
Can I make this recipe vegan/gluten-free?
To make this recipe vegan, replace the cream cheese with a high-quality vegan cream cheese alternative and use a vegan whipped topping. Ensure your cherry pie filling is vegan as well (many store-bought ones are, but check labels). For gluten-free, this recipe is naturally gluten-free, as none of the core ingredients contain gluten.

Delectable Cherry Cheesecake Fluff
- Total Time: 1 hour 15 minutes
- Yield: 6 1x
Description
A light and airy no-bake dessert combining creamy cheesecake elements with sweet cherries.
Ingredients
- 8 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 8 oz frozen whipped topping, thawed
- 21 oz cherry pie filling
Instructions
- In a large mixing bowl, beat the cream cheese until smooth.
- Gradually add powdered sugar and vanilla extract, mixing until well combined.
- Fold in the whipped topping gently until fully incorporated.
- Spoon the mixture into serving dishes or a large bowl.
- Top with cherry pie filling and ref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ving.
Notes
For a lighter version, use low-fat cream cheese and whipped topping. Store leftovers in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
